Death toll rises sharply on Algarve roads

accident125From the beginning of the year to February 15th, there have been 1,005 accidents on the Algarve's roads with seven deaths, according to data from the National Highway Safety Authority.

The number of crashes increased on the same period in previous years with 894 accidents in 2015 and 929 last year.

More serious is the increase in the number of deaths resulting from these accidents. In this month and a half so far in 2017, there have been seven fatal accidents representing a increase of six deaths over last year.

The Algarve suffered the fourth highest number of road accident deaths in the country, behind Santarém, with 11 victims, followed by Oporto and Setúbal, both with eight.

The figures only credit deaths that happen at the accident scene or when carrying victims to hospital, meaning that the actual number of deaths resulting from crashes in the Algarve and elsewhere, is higher.

There were five fewer seriously injured in the period, down to 13 this year compared to last, but this is two more than in 2015.
